第一种、常规做法
1.1 杀掉adb服务 :adb kill-server
1.2 到开发者设置中,撤销usb调试权限。
1.3 关闭usb调试开关,拔掉数据线。
1.4 打开usb调试权限,插入数据线。
1.5 重启adb服务:adb start-server,或者adb devices ,注意:手机上的授予权限弹窗,授予权限后,重新执行adb devices。
若第一种方式按照步骤执行完成后,还是无法授予权限,显示unauthorized。可以尝试第二种方式。
第二种:
查看Android设备的vid和pid方式
adb shell
查看VID:(oppo1:22d9)
cat /sys/class/android_usb/android0/idVendor
查看PID:(oppo2:276c)
cat /sys/class/android_usb/android0/idProduct
在PC端~/.android/目录下新建adb_usb.ini文件,有则不用新建。
打开输入VID。